Table 9-5-4 <br /> Guide to and Areal Extent of Soil Types Identified for <br /> The Nucla East Baseline Soil Survey <br /> Montrose County, Colorado <br /> 1 Area Percent <br /> Symbol Mapping Unit (Acres) of Total <br /> 1E Travessilla-Pinon channery sandy <br /> loams Complex, 3-30% slopes 117.0 19.3 <br /> 1EW Lithic Haplaquolls, <br /> 1-6% slopes 17.7 2.9 <br /> 20C Bowdish-Lazear sandy clay loams Complex, <br /> 3-15% slopes 27.0 4.5 <br /> 30C Progresso-Bond Complex, <br /> 2-15% slopes 176.0 29.0 <br /> 70B Barx sandy loam, <br /> 1-4% slopes 153.0 25.2 <br /> D70B Barx sandy loam - Barx scalped - <br /> Barx buried Complex, <br /> 1-4% slopes 20.0 3.3 <br /> 808 Lithic/Typic Haplaquolls, shallow <br /> to deep, 1-3% slopes 64.0 10.5 <br /> 810 Typic Haplaquolls, deep, <br /> 1-3% slopes 29.3 4.8 <br /> P Ponds 3.2 0.5 <br /> Wet Spot -- -- <br /> 607.2 100.0 <br /> 1 No separate miscellaneous mapping units were established for roads or farmyards. These <br /> units comprised about 19 and 12 acres, respectively of the 607.2 acre study area. <br /> 9-5-24 Revised 04/11/88 <br />
